What is a government program manager?

A Government Program Manager oversees and coordinates government-funded programs, ensuring they meet objectives, stay within budget, and comply with regulations. They manage project timelines, lead teams, and collaborate with stakeholders to achieve program goals. Responsibilities include strategic planning, risk management, and performance evaluation. Strong leadership, communication, and analytical skills are essential for success in this role.

What are some common challenges faced by government program managers and how do they address them?

Government Program Managers often encounter challenges such as evolving policy requirements, tight budgets, and coordinating efforts between multiple agencies or departments. To address these issues, they rely on robust planning, transparent communication, and effective stakeholder engagement to anticipate changes and mitigate risks. They also stay current with regulatory updates and actively seek ways to streamline processes. Being proactive and adaptable helps them ensure projects remain on track and compliant, even in a dynamic government environ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a government program manager, and why are they important?

A Government Program Manager should possess strong project management skills, budgeting expertise, and a thorough understanding of government regulations, often supported by a relevant degree and PMP or similar certification. Experience with tools like Microsoft Project, government financial systems, and procurement platforms is highly beneficial. Outstanding soft skills such as problem-solving, adaptability, and communication help build consensus among diverse stakeholders and navigate complex bureaucratic environments. These abilities are crucial for successfully managing multi-faceted government projects while ensuring adherence to deadlines, budgets, and compliance requirements.

Westlands Water District is seeking an accomplished and politically astute executive to serve as the Deputy General Manager – Government & Public Affairs. Reporting to the General Manager, this position will provide strategic leadership for the District’s government affairs, legislative advocacy, public affairs, communications, stakeholder engagement, and external relations program. The successful candidate will serve as a principal advisor to executive leadership and represent the District before policymakers, regulatory agencies, industry organizations, stakeholders, and the media.

The position may be headquartered in either the District's Fresno or Sacramento Office. Due to the nature of government relations, stakeholder engagement, legislative advocacy, Board-related activities, and public meetings, the position requires frequent travel throughout the District service area, Central Valley, and California, as well as occasional out-of-state travel. Attendance at evening and weekend meetings and events may also be required.

Minimum Qualifications:
  • A b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university in Public Administration, Public Policy, Political Science, Communications, Business Administration, Agriculture, Environmental Studies, Economics, Engineering, or a closely related field; and
  • Eight (8) years of progressively responsible experience in government affairs, legislative advocacy, public affairs, communications, public policy, water resources, public agency administration, or a closely related field; and
  • Of the eight (8) years, at least three (3) years include supervisory or management experience.

Desirable Qualifications:
  • A master's degree in a related field is desirable.
  • Experience working with elected officials, governmental agencies, trade associations, consultants, stakeholders, and public policy organizations is highly desirable.
  • Experience in California water policy, agriculture, natural resources, public utilities, or public agency administration is highly desirable.
  • Experience managing external consultants, advocacy firms, communications professionals, and government affairs contractors is preferred.
